On 23.11.2022 17:49, Jani Nikula wrote:
Remove rmw_set(), rmw_clear(), clear_register(), rmw_set_fw(), and
rmw_clear_fw(). They're just one too many levels of abstraction for
register access, for very specific purposes.

clear_register() seems like a micro-optimization bypassing the write
when the register is already clear, but that trick has ceased to work
since commit 06b975d58fd6 ("drm/i915: make intel_uncore_rmw() write
unconditionally"). Just clear the register in the most obvious way.
